There was one interview where it was told to access this online image editor (which I had never used) and start building out the mock-up. I spent so much time trying to figure out how to use the tool and set up a dev environment that I got nothing done in the hour they gave me. I was so frustrated trying to orientate myself that I didn’t even want the job.

It got even worse because I had to jump into a Redux project and pair program with the developer. “Ok so here is a bunch of code, now let’s add this feature.” So after just trying to get familiar with the code and get something working. I told the interviewer, “ I’m Just trying to get it working; then I can go back and clean it up.” In the end, I got marked down for “my coding style.”
